The Grantebridgescire story arc in Assassin's Creed Valhalla presents players with one of the game's earliest and most compelling narrative puzzles. As Eivor, you must help the Viking leader Soma reclaim her home while identifying a hidden turncoat within her inner circle. This choice-driven investigation forces you to carefully examine environmental clues, cross-examine close allies, and weigh personal ambitions against loyalty.

The Traitor Among the Inner Circle

The core of the mystery revolves around Soma's three trusted advisors: Birna, Lifs, and Galinn. Each lieutenant possesses a distinct personality and a unique relationship with their leader, making the investigation deeply personal. After a thorough review of the evidence, Galinn is revealed as the true traitor who sold out Grantebridge to the Saxons.

Galinn's betrayal is fueled by his fanatical belief in his own prophetic visions, which convinced him that he was destined for greatness without Soma. His obsession with his destiny ultimately blinded him to the values of loyalty and camaraderie that held the clan together.

Uncovering the Evidence in Grantebridgescire

Players can piece together the truth by exploring the surrounding areas and talking to local residents. Crucial evidence includes a painted longship and a secret tunnel used by the attackers to infiltrate the city. Investigating these leads reveals that Galinn painted his stolen ship in a specific color to safely navigate past Saxon patrols.

Cross-referencing the testimonies of the advisors helps eliminate Birna and Lifs from suspicion, as their motives align with rebuilding their community. By paying close attention to these small environmental details, players can confidently accuse the right suspect when confronting Soma.

Consequences of Your Choice for the Raven Clan

Accusing Galinn correctly leads to a swift resolution where Soma executes the traitor and restores order to her settlement. This outcome secures a powerful, lasting alliance between Soma's forces and the Raven Clan for future battles across England. Additionally, Birna will choose to leave Grantebridge and officially join your crew as a loyal raider.

If you mistakenly accuse Birna or Lifs, the innocent advisor will die, and Galinn will later reveal his true colors during a tragic confrontation. This failure deeply breaks Soma's trust, leaving her emotionally distant and changing the dynamic of your alliance throughout the rest of your journey.
